UCI Fuel Cell— 1.4 MW Natural Gas
UCI Fuel Cell is a 1.4 MW gas power plant in the United States, operated by UCI Fuel Cell LLC since 2015. Ranked #1815 of 1883 gas plants in the United States. Its 1.4 MW represents 0.0002% of the total gas capacity in the United States, which is 592,244 MW. The largest gas plant in the United States is the West County Energy Center at 4,263 MW, making UCI Fuel Cell 3.04 times smaller. Nearby plants include San Onofre Nuclear Generating Station (2254 MW, Nuclear), Alamitos Generating Station (1893 MW, Gas), and Haynes (1739.1 MW, Gas). The facility is located in California, approximately 80 km south of Los Angeles.
